What Are Mobile Stairlifts and How Do They Help Seniors?
Mobile stairlifts are portable devices designed to assist people with limited mobility to safely navigate stairs without permanent installation. Unlike traditional stairlifts fixed to staircases, these machines can be moved and set up quickly, often within 24 to 48 hours, without drilling or changing the home’s structure.
They are useful for:
- Seniors recovering from surgery
- Temporary mobility limitations
- Individuals living in rented homes
- Those wanting to try stairlift use before committing to permanent solutions
- Caregivers assisting elderly relatives during visits
These stairlifts typically feature safety components such as belts, brakes, and emergency stop buttons, meeting UK safety standard BS EN 81-40:2020.
Types of Mobile Stairlifts Available in 2025
Manual Mobile Stairlifts
- Operated by a caregiver, these models require no electricity or batteries.
- Suitable for short-term help when caregiver assistance is present.
- Approximate UK market cost: £1,250.
Battery-Powered Mobile Stairlifts
- Equipped with rechargeable batteries, giving users more autonomy.
- Ideal for seniors who wish to operate the stairlift independently.
- Prices vary from £1,360 to £8,990, depending on features.
Stair Climbers (Portable Stair Lifts for Wheelchair Users)
- Specifically designed for wheelchair users or those carrying heavier weight.
- Attach to or support wheelchairs, allowing users to stay seated.
- Price range: £4,100 to £10,995+.
- Portable, foldable, and capable of handling straight or some curved stairs.
Standing Stairlifts
- As of 2025, mobile standing stairlifts are unavailable.
- Standing stairlifts require fixed installation and extra safety features, thus are typically permanent fixtures.

Cost Considerations and Rental Options
Purchasing Costs
- Manual mobile stairlifts: Approximately £1,250.
- Battery-powered stairlifts: Between £1,360 and £8,990.
- Portable stair climbers: £4,100 to over £10,995, based on specifications.
Rental Costs
- Rentals are often chosen for temporary use such as recovery after surgery or short visits.
- Typical rental fees range from about £10 to £15 per week.
- Rentals include fast, no-drill installation and may offer options to convert rental into purchase.
- Renting provides flexibility and avoids upfront purchase expenses.
Maintenance
- Annual maintenance usually costs between £100 and £300.
- Regular servicing helps maintain safety and extend device life.
Who Might Benefit from Mobile Stairlifts and How to Acquire One?
Mobile stairlifts may suit:
- Seniors and elderly people with limited mobility.
- Individuals with temporary injuries or disabilities.
- Residents in homes where permanent installation isn’t possible.
- Wheelchair users utilizing portable stair climbers.
In the UK, eligible users may apply for financial aid such as the Disabled Facilities Grant (DFG) to help with costs. Many suppliers also offer financing options, including installment plans via providers like Kanda Finance, making stairlift purchase more manageable.
When choosing a stairlift:
- Consider stair type (straight, curved, outdoor).
- Assess the level of independence needed (manual-assisted or battery-powered).
- Evaluate weight capacity requirements.
- Consult mobility professionals for accurate measurements and product advice.
Features and Alternatives to Mobile Stairlifts
Steps That Transform into a Lift Concept:Currently, no broadly available mobile stairlifts feature steps that mechanically convert into lifts. This idea remains in development.
Portable Stair Climbers:These alternatives serve wheelchair users or individuals preferring to stay seated when climbing stairs without permanent home modifications. They fold for convenience and handle various stair designs safely.
Standing Stair Lifts: Information for Seniors
Standing stair lifts are generally fixed units designed for users who stand while moving between floors. Mobile or portable standing stairlifts do not exist, so those requiring such solutions should consider professionally installed fixed models.
